Step 1
Preheat oven to 400ºF
Step 2
Begin frying bacon pieces in pan over medium heat. While bacon is frying, prep asparagus and shrimp.
Step 3
Fry bacon until firm but not totally crisp. Remove bacon from pan and set aside.
Step 4
Arrange asparagus in an even layer on a large greased rimmed sheet pan. Drizzle 2 Tb olive oil over asparagus. Season with salt and pepper.
Step 5
Roast for 7 minutes. (add 1-2 minutes if asparagus is extra thick)
Step 6
Toss shrimp with 2 Tb olive oil, salt and pepper. Add to pan with partially cooked asparagus.
Step 7
Top asparagus with par-cooked bacon pieces.
Step 8
Roast for 5-7 minutes or until shrimp turn pink and curl into a loose 'C' shape.
Step 9
Remove from oven. Serve with pasta, rice or on top of a salad.
Step 10
Combine all dressing ingredients in a major jar with lid or a dressing shaker. Shake vigorously for 30-60 seconds to blend.
Step 11
Serve tossed with pasta or rice. Or use as a dressing for salad.
